Borussia Dortmund sporting director Michael Zorc has dismissed speculation that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ang is on the cusp of joining Paris Saint-Germain.

A report from Yahoo Sport! France claimed that the Gabon international had agreed on a deal to join Les Parisiens after the Ligue 1 club agreed on a £61m sum with BvB.

However, this has been quickly denied by Zorc, who insists that the club have yet to receive an official offer from any of the elite clubs.

"As of now, we have not received any offers from any club across the world." he is quoted as saying on The Mail.

The former Saint-Etienne man enjoyed his best spell in the BvB last term as he bagged 40 goals across all competitions including the winning penalty in the DFB Pokal final against Eintracht Frankfurt.

Aubameyang has already admitted that he could switch clubs during the summer transfer window, and it is only a matter of time before he could play for one of the bigger clubs in Europe.

The 27-year-old has amassed 120 goals in 189 outings for the German giants since arriving from Ligue 1 back in the summer of 2013.
